The full breakdown

What it's made of and why it matters

Tom's Most-Loved uses mineral actives (primarily potassium alum or similar salts) and plant-derived fragrance and conditioning agents in a stick format, avoiding synthetic polymer antiperspirant compounds like aluminum zirconium. Mineral-based formulas carry minimal risk of volatile organic compound off-gassing or coating degradation common in spray or gel deodorants. The stick vehicle itself (typically wax and stearic acid bases) is stable at skin temperature and shows no documented leaching hazards under normal use conditions. This formulation class sidesteps many synthetic antimicrobial and preservative concerns present in conventional alternatives.

How it compares in its category

Mineral-based stick deodorants occupy a lower-risk segment compared to antiperspirant sprays (which carry solvent and aerosol inhalation concerns) and heavy synthetic deodorants relying on triclosan or other antimicrobials. Tom's positioning aligns with consumer expectations for plant-derived and minimal-chemistry options, and its pricing reflects this positioning fairly. Competitors in the mineral/natural segment (e.g., Crystal, Schmidt's) use similar chemistries; Tom's historical disclosure record is comparable or stronger than most peers in this category.

If you buy it

Apply sparingly to clean, dry skin; mineral deodorants work best when sweat and bacteria loads are low, so daily bathing enhances effectiveness. Store in a cool, dry place away from direct heat or humidity, as mineral salts can cake or separate if exposed to prolonged moisture (not a safety issue, but reduces usability). Replace when the stick is depleted or if odor efficacy noticeably drops; typical use life is 2-4 months depending on application frequency. No special handling or maintenance is required; the formulation is stable across normal storage conditions.

Beyond PFAS: other things we checked

Established hazard classes for this product type, assessed from public information. These never change the PFAS grade; a Likely flag caps the Verdict at “Buy with care.”

Possible

Fragrance allergens

Tom's uses plant-derived fragrance components; while generally lower-risk than synthetic fragrance mixes, essential oils and botanical extracts can trigger contact dermatitis or respiratory sensitivity in susceptible individuals. Specific allergen disclosure is limited to general ingredient listing, not fragrance component breakdown.

Possible

Skin irritation from mineral salts

Potassium alum and similar mineral actives are generally safe, but prolonged or high-concentration application to abraded or sensitive skin can cause transient irritation, dryness, or stinging. Risk is low with proper application technique and normal skin integrity.

None known

Formaldehyde-releasing preservatives

No evidence of formaldehyde releasers (e.g., dmdm hydantoin, imidazolidinyl urea) in published ingredient lists for this product; Tom's typically avoids these due to brand positioning toward natural preservation.

None known

Heavy metal contamination in mineral actives

Potassium alum and plant-derived minerals used in Tom's formulations are not documented to carry lead, cadmium, or arsenic contamination in regulatory or independent testing databases. Mineral mining standards and supplier vetting are not publicly detailed, but no safety alerts have been issued.

None known

Microplastic or particle migration

Mineral stick deodorants do not shed microplastics because they are salt or wax-based, not synthetic polymer-based. No environmental or dermal accumulation concern is associated with this product type.
